Tema anterior: getRelatedListTema siguiente: getPendingChangeTaskListForContact


getRelatedListValues

Los siguientes parámetros se aplican al método getRelatedListValues:

Parámetro

Tipo

Descripción

SID

Entero

Identifica la sesión recuperada del inicio de sesión.

objectHandle

Cadena

Determina el identificador de objeto.

listName

Cadena

Identifica un nombre de atributo de tipo lista para el objeto.

numToFetch

Entero

Representa el número máximo de filas que desea devolver.

  • No puede ser cero.
  • Especifique -1 para devolver todas las filas.

Nota: Independientemente del número entero especificado, Servicios Web puede devolver un máximo de 250 filas por llamada.

atributos

Cadena[]

Identifica una matriz de uno o más nombres de atributo para los que se van a buscar valores. Se permiten nombres con puntos.

getRelatedListValuesResult

String Holder

Identifica el objeto String Holder para capturar los datos devueltos.

numRowsFound

Integer Holder

Identifica el objeto Integer Holder para capturar los datos devueltos.

Description

Devuelve valores para listas relacionadas con un objeto determinado. Las listas se deben definir como QREL o BREL. Utilice los métodos de LREL para consultar los tipos de LREL.

Por ejemplo, el objeto de solicitud tiene una lista relacionada denominada “children”, que contiene sus solicitudes secundarias. Este método es una alternativa de lista sin identificador para getRelatedList(). El formato devuelto es parecido a getListValues(), de acuerdo con lo que se indica a continuación:

<numRowsFound>
< UDSObjectList >
<UDSObject>
<Handle>
<AttributeName0>
<AttributeName1>

Se puede recuperar información sobre los atributos de la lista de objetos mediante el esquema de objetos (majic). Un método alternativo consiste en utilizar getObjectTypeInformation().

Resultado

Este método incluye las devoluciones siguientes:

Elemento XML

Tipo

Descripción

<getRelatedListValuesResult>

N/D

Identifica el elemento externo, <UDSObjectList>, que contiene una secuencia de elementos <UDSObject>. Cada elemento <UDSObject> contiene un elemento <Handle> y cero o más elementos <AttributeNameX>.

<numRowsFound>

Entero

Indica el número total de filas de la lista consultada.

Nota: El número total de filas no necesariamente es el número de filas devueltas.